Brothel house raided in Gampaha
Posted by Editor on May 7, 2013 - 12:06 pm

Three alleged female sex workers and a man were arrested by the Gampaha Police during a raid conducted at a house in the Yakkala area yesterday.
It was alleged that the house was used for prostitution purposes for a long time in a subtle manner.
The three women aged 21, 23 and 43 are residents of Kurunegala, Walauwatta and Sadikkawatta areas.
Suspects are to be produced before the Gampaha Magistrate’s Court today. (Courtesy: DM Online)
